Software engineer's contract varied to prohibit slander by scorned former employer

In an s106 unfair contract ruling, the NSW IRC, in Court Session, has for the first time issued a permanent prohibition order to prevent a software engineer's former employer from slandering him, and awarded him $22,000 in damages for defamation already suffered.
